Our luxury journey begins, naturally, with shopping. Cairo offers a fascinating blend of traditional markets and high-end designer boutiques. The Khan el-Khalili bazaar, a sensory overload of sights, sounds, and smells, is a must-visit. Here, amidst the labyrinthine alleys, you'll find everything from exquisite hand-woven carpets and intricately crafted silver jewelry to fragrant spices and aromatic oils. Bargaining is expected and encouraged – it's all part of the fun! Budget at least half a day for exploration and shopping, with potential spending ranging from EGP 500 to EGP 5000 (depending on your purchases).

For a more refined experience, head to the upscale Zamalek district, home to designer boutiques showcasing both international and local talent. Think elegant dresses, bespoke tailoring, and unique handcrafted items. Here you’ll find brands like Gucci, Prada etc in luxury shopping malls such as City Stars and Mall of Arabia. Expect to spend significantly more here; budget at least EGP 10,000 to EGP 50,000+, depending on your tastes. Afterwards, indulge in a luxurious high tea experience at a five-star hotel, costing approximately EGP 1,500-3,000.

Speaking of food, Cairo offers a culinary adventure to match its shopping experiences. Sample Kushari, Egypt's national dish – a delightful mix of lentils, rice, pasta, chickpeas, and a spicy tomato sauce. A delicious and affordable meal can be had for around EGP 100-200. For a truly memorable dining experience, try a fine-dining restaurant with traditional Egyptian cuisine and a modern twist. Expect to pay EGP 1,000-3,000 per meal.

Getting around is easy and luxurious. You can hire a private car with a driver for the duration of your stay, at an average cost of EGP 500-1000 per day. Alternatively, ride-hailing services like Uber and Careem are readily available and cost-effective. Taxis are also an option but always confirm the price beforehand. Remember to factor in tips for your driver, approximately 10-15% of the fare.

Accessibility in Cairo is improving, but navigating independently can be challenging. Taxis are readily available and relatively inexpensive, approximately 50-100 EGP for shorter journeys, but haggling is expected. Uber is also a convenient option. The Cairo Metro is a cost-effective way to get around, costing around 3 EGP per ride. For those who prefer a more luxurious experience, private car services are easily arranged, with prices varying depending on the vehicle and duration.

Winter in Cairo boasts pleasant weather, averaging highs of 18-22°C (64-72°F) and lows of around 10-14°C (50-57°F). It’s the ideal time to explore the ancient sites without the intense summer heat. Remember to pack layers, as temperatures can fluctuate throughout the day.

Indulge your senses with Cairo's culinary delights. Expect to spend around 200-500 EGP per meal depending on your choice of restaurant. From the flavorful street food like koshari (a lentil, rice, and macaroni dish) to fine dining experiences in luxury hotels, Cairo offers a diverse gastronomic landscape. Don't miss the opportunity to sample traditional Egyptian sweets like basbousa and kunafa.
